It is the Madagascar Game. And before you say it Tara I refuse to call them by that French name!! There are still some pure Mad. Games in SE Asia high in the mountains of Viet Nam and Cambodia. They are a highly intellegent bird that will take care of family above all.

Here is a specimin that is mounted in a museum somewhere in the North of France.

http://i41.photobucket.com/albums/e266/NNBREEDER/131malgache_france_1dc.jpg

And here are three drawings, I believe that the pen and ink of the pair was done in the 1800s and the color one was done in the 1920s. The other one looks pretty modern to me.
